The Stewardship team of the Southeast Gardens is responsible for managing and maintaining a diverse portfolio of properties in the Greater Boston area, including historic homes, parks, and public gardens. Based at the Eleanor Cabot Bradley Estate in Canton, our team is engaged in all aspects of property care to support the mission of the Trustees and to ensure that these special places are protected, and preserved, in perpetuity for the public good.

The Steward is a seasonal position, responsible for the upkeep and maintenance of the properties in the Greater Boston Area between the months of May and October. This position also supports Engagement staff in the preparation of seasonal events.

About The Trustees:

The Trustees places are open to all, and we thrive by involving as many people as possible in what we do. Founded in 1891 by a group of visionary volunteers, we preserve, for public use and enjoyment, properties of exceptional scenic, historic, and ecological value in Massachusetts. We aim to protect special places for future generations to enjoy in perpetuity. We have helped protect more than 50,000 acres, including 27,000+ acres on more than 120 reservations that are open to the public. We are a non-profit conservation organization funded and supported entirely by our visitors, supporters, volunteers, and our 100,000 Member households
